Vitamin Toxicity: When Excess Becomes Harmful
While the body requires micronutrients in small amounts to function optimally, excessive intake—particularly from supplements—can lead to toxicity. Vitamins are classified into two categories: water-soluble (like vitamins C and B-complex) and fat-soluble (vitamins A, D, E, and K). Water-soluble vitamins are generally excreted through urine when consumed in excess, making them less likely to accumulate in the body. Fat-soluble vitamins, on the other hand, are stored in the liver and fatty tissues, increasing the risk of toxicity.
Vitamin A is one of the most well-documented vitamins associated with liver toxicity. Chronic high intake—usually above 10,000 IU per day—can lead to hypervitaminosis A, manifesting in liver enlargement, hepatocellular damage, and even fibrosis. Symptoms may include headache, nausea, fatigue, irritability, and jaundice. Similarly, excessive vitamin D intake, often from high-dose supplementation, can lead to hypercalcemia and liver-related side effects due to calcification and inflammation.
In contrast, while water-soluble vitamins are often safer, certain B vitamins like niacin (vitamin B3) in high doses used for cholesterol management can cause liver enzyme elevation and toxicity. The accumulation of such substances places metabolic stress on the liver, decreasing its detox capabilities and leading to oxidative stress.

Supplement Liver Health: Protecting Your Liver While Supplementing
As the primary organ responsible for detoxification, the liver metabolizes various compounds, including medications, alcohol, and dietary supplements. Each of these substances undergoes enzymatic conversion within the liver, sometimes producing metabolites that can either detoxify or, conversely, become toxic intermediates.
Supplements containing high concentrations of certain nutrients can overload hepatic metabolic pathways, leading to hepatotoxicity. Individuals with compromised liver function—such as those suffering from fatty liver disease, cirrhosis, or hepatitis—are at a significantly higher risk. Equally, continued exposure to environmental toxins or lifestyle factors like alcohol use can increase liver sensitivity to supplements.
To protect liver health, it is critical to consider the timing and dosage of supplementation, ensure adequate hydration, avoid unnecessary combination products, and refrain from using supplements not backed by scientific or regulatory bodies. Avoiding alcohol while supplementing is strongly recommended.
Consulting with healthcare practitioners before initiating any new supplement—especially high-potency multivitamins—is imperative. Regular checkups and liver function tests (like ALT, AST, and bilirubin levels) can detect early hepatic distress. Over-the-Counter Multivitamins: Accessibility and Safety Considerations
One of the major appeals of multivitamins is their accessibility. Available over the counter (OTC) in health stores, pharmacies, and online, they are often perceived as benign due to their non-prescription status. However, this ease of access can be deceptive.
Unlike prescription medications, dietary supplements in many jurisdictions aren’t subject to the same rigorous pre-market testing. Regulatory oversight focuses on labeling and adverse event reporting, but the quality, potency, and purity of OTC products can vary widely. Ingredients might differ in actual concentration from what's listed, or worse, be contaminated with heavy metals or unapproved pharmaceutical compounds.
When selecting a multivitamin, consumers should look for regulatory seals, third-party testing verification, and transparent ingredient listing. Liver Toxicity Risk: Assessing the Potential Dangers of Multivitamin Use
While multivitamins are generally safe when used as directed, there are documented cases where supplement ingestion has led to liver injury. The risk is typically dose-dependent and influenced by individual health factors, genetic makeup, and concurrent substance use.
Several case studies and reviews have identified hepatotoxicity related to vitamin A and supplements containing green tea extract, niacin, and other less common ingredients. According to peer-reviewed literature and regulatory health bulletins, liver injury from multivitamins is rare but possible. Identifying which component in a multivitamin formulation is responsible becomes especially challenging due to the multicomponent nature of these products.
Individuals with pre-existing liver conditions, those taking multiple hepatically metabolized medications (such as statins or antiepileptic drugs), and heavy alcohol users should exercise particularly high vigilance. The interaction of alcohol with fat-soluble vitamin overdoses, for example, can dramatically amplify toxicity.

Vitamin Overdose Symptoms: Recognizing the Signs of Excessive Intake
Early recognition of overdose symptoms can prevent serious consequences, including liver failure. While symptoms may vary depending on the vitamin, the liver often shows signs of distress through common systemic symptoms.
Signs of vitamin overdose with hepatic involvement include fatigue, loss of appetite, nausea, vomiting, jaundice (yellowing of the skin or eyes), dark-colored urine, and pain in the upper right abdomen. Blood test abnormalities might include elevated ALT/AST levels, increased bilirubin, and altered coagulation factors.
For instance, chronic vitamin D toxicity may present with hypercalcemia, calcification of organs, including the liver, and metabolic disruptions. Vitamin A toxicity can manifest acutely or chronically and is particularly dangerous due to its cumulative nature in liver tissue.
